The Australian Federal Police (AFP) received a referral on 22 November 2017 from the US-based National Centre for Missing and Exploited Children (NCMEC) alerting police to the man’s illegal activities.
Officer’s conducted two search warrants in Blacktown, Sydney today (17 January 2018) and seized electronic devices containing a large amount of child exploitation material.
Following the search warrant the man was charged with;
Police will allege the man uploaded child exploitation material online, including videos and images.
The man is scheduled to appear in the Blacktown Local Court on Thursday 18 January 2018.
